How Our Commercial Storage Process Works
When you are responsible for keeping a business running smoothly, you need a storage solution that is simple and predictable. We have designed our process so you know what to expect, from your first call to final pickup.
- Your experience usually starts with a quick conversation about what you are storing and where the container will go. We talk through basic details such as the type of business, how much space you think you need, and any access considerations on your property. Then we help you choose a container size and schedule a delivery date that fits your calendar.
- On delivery day, our driver brings the container to your business location and places it in the agreed-upon spot. We pay close attention to clearance, slopes, and traffic flow, and we focus on leaving enough room for vehicles, customers, and staff to move safely. Because our containers are ground level and use padded wheels, placement is smooth and controlled.
- Once the container is set, you and your team load it at your own pace. Some businesses fill a container in a single day during a planned shutdown. Others gradually move items over a week or more while staying open. You have the flexibility to decide what works best for your schedule and your staff.
- After the container is loaded, you have two basic options. Many businesses keep the container on site for the duration of their project so everything is close at hand. Others prefer to free up space and have us move the loaded container to our secure storage location until they need it again. You can choose the approach that best supports your operations.
When you are ready, we schedule pickup. We coordinate timing so we arrive when it least disrupts your business, such as before opening, after closing, or during a quieter period if that is available. Our team works to keep communication clear, so you know when the container will arrive and when it will be removed.
Commercial Uses For Portable Containers
Every business has its own reasons for needing extra space. Portable storage gives you room to work without committing to permanent construction or long-term leases. We serve a wide range of commercial customers in this area, from small shops to larger facilities.
Here are a few common ways businesses use our containers:
- Short-term storage during remodels, expansions, or repairs at commercial properties
- Jobsite storage for tools, equipment, and building materials for trades and contractors
- Seasonal inventory storage for retailers and service businesses during busy periods
- Temporary storage for furniture, files, and equipment during office reconfigurations
- Event-related storage for equipment, signage, and supplies for organizations and venues
In each of these situations, containers help you clear space inside, reduce clutter, and protect valuable items. Because you can keep the container on site or have it stored for you, you maintain control over how accessible those items need to be.

Frequently Asked Questions
How long can my business keep a container?
You can generally keep a container for as long as you need it, within our flexible rental terms. Many businesses use containers for a few weeks, while others keep them for several months during larger projects. We work with you to align the rental period with your schedule.
Will the container damage our parking lot or driveway?
Our containers are designed to minimize impact on your surfaces. They are ground level and use padded wheels that help protect asphalt and concrete during placement. We also discuss placement in advance so we can avoid fragile areas and choose a spot that supports long-term use.
How secure are the containers for valuable inventory?
Our containers include advanced security features to help protect what you store. Strong construction and secure locking points make it difficult for unauthorized access. Many businesses trust them for tools, equipment, and retail goods, and we recommend you use quality locks for added protection.
Can you place a container at our jobsite or storefront?
We place containers at many different commercial locations, including jobsites, storefronts, and office properties. As long as a safe, accessible spot is available for our truck and the container, we can usually find a workable solution. We discuss placement with you ahead of time to plan for access.
What sizes are available for commercial storage?
We offer several container sizes so you can choose one that fits your project and property. Smaller containers work well for compact sites or limited inventory, while larger options are better for big renovations or multiple rooms of contents. Our team helps you match size to your specific needs.
